1. ORA-12504 错误的含义 ORA-12504 错误是 Oracle 数据库中的一个常见网络错误,具体含义为:“TNS was not given the SERVICE_NAME in CONNECT_DATA”。这意味着在尝试建立数据库连接时,TNS 监听器没有从 CONNECT_DATA 中获取到必要的 SERVICE_NAME 或 SID(System Identifier),因此无法完成连接请求。 2. 可能...
是指在使用Python连接Oracle数据库时,使用EZConnect语法进行连接时出现了ORA-12504错误。 ORA-12504错误表示数据库实例无法识别。这通常是由于连接字符串中指定的数据库服务名或SID错误导致的。EZConnect语法是一种简化的连接字符串语法,可以通过主机名、端口号和服务名来连接Oracle数据库。
但是登录的时候发现报错:ORA-12504. 2.于是,我首先通过lsnrctl status看Oracle listener监听器状态,发现正常。 3.tnsping 数据库实例服务名,发现是空的。于是我终于找到了问题。 4.我找到文件夹D:\app\linxi\product\11.2.0\dbhome_1\NETWORK\ADMIN,然后新建tnsnames.ora文件,内容如下: orcl = (DESCRIPTION = ...
(CONNECT_DATA = (SERVICE_NAME=dbnameserver.host.com) ) ) On some client machines i get below error when i try use sqlplus to log on datbase like (sqlplus username/passwd@DBNAMESERVER) but on other client machines(in the same configuration) it's work perfectly;) ORA-12504: TNS:listener ...
1ERROR:ORA-12504:TNS:监听程序在 CONNECT_DATA 中未获得 SERVICE_NAME使用本地的SQLPlus连接服务器上的Oracle数据库,系统先提示ORA-12504:TNS:监听程序在 CONNECT_DATA 中未获得 SERVICE_NAME再次输入用户名密码系统又提示ORA-12560:TNS:协议适配器错误.如图所示 c管理员命令提示符- sqlplus’ systen/ora1ed@192168...
首先,可以尝试重新启动数据库服务和TNS监听器。通过重新启动这两个组件,有时候可以解决ORA-12504错误。其次,可以检查网络连接和配置,确保网络连接是稳定的并且配置是正确的。最后,如果以上方法都无效,可以尝试重新配置TNS监听器和数据库连接信息。通过正确配置TNS监听器和数据库连接信息,有时候也可以解决ORA-12504错误。
1.昨天我刚安装完Oracle11g R2的Oracle数据库。安装完PL/SQL客户端后需要登录到Oracle数据库。但是登录的时候发现报错:ORA-12504. 2.于是,我首先通过lsnrctl status看Oracle listener监听器状态,发现正常。 3.tnsping数据库实例服务名,发现是空的。于是我终于找到了问题。
ORA-12504: TNS:listener wasnot given the SERVICE_NAMEin CONNECT_DATA 解决办法: 说明:其实上面出现这样的情况是在tnsname.ora中配置错了,将tnsname.ora中的ADDRESS_LIST参数去掉就行了。 最终的tnsname.ora中的配置变为: [oracle@sm2 admin]$ cat tnsnames.ora ...
这个是我的tnsnames.ora的配置,参考下:SID_LIST_LISTENER = (SID_LIST = (SID_DESC = (SID_NAME = PLSExtProc)(ORACLE_HOME = /u01/app/oracle/product/11.2.0/dbhome_1)(PROGRAM = extproc))(SID_DESC = (GLOBAL_DBNAME = sidb26)(ORACLE_HOME = /u01/app/oracle/product/11.2.0...
解决:在数据库服务器上的oracle/network/admin/sqlnet.ora文件添加一行SQLNET.ALLOWED_LOGON_VERSION=8,重启数据库,重新连接数据库,可以成功连接,问题解决。 11、任何ArcGIS连接Oracle问题 描述:ArcMap、ArcCatalog连接Oracle失败问题 原因:一般会直接弹出错误信息,若信息不全,请参考%TEMP% 目录中的 sdedc_Oracle.log ...